## Account Recovery — Trailnote Offline Mode

When a surveyor's Trailnote app has been offline for 30+ days, their local credentials expire and sync refuses to resume. Don't make them wipe the device — all their unsynced field data lives there! Instead, open the support console, pick "Offline Reinstate," and enter their handle. The console will ask for the support team's shared recovery passphrase before issuing a reinstatement token. Use the one below.

unlock words, bagaf-fajeg: zorael-kelax-fraath-quenix-eliok-sileth-aldmir-wenir-druiel

- [ ] Step 7: Archive cold storage buckets (Glacierline tier). Confirm both ceremony witnesses are present, verify bucket manifests match the Oxbow ledger, then seal the archive key shares. Plugin authors may observe but not handle shares. Once sealed, the archive index itself is encrypted and can only be reopened with the passphrase below.

vault phrase of badup-hahig = tamael-aldael-kelmir-istael-fenok-istwyn-tamius-jorath-oliion

**14:22 — Seat-map renderer degradation (Gildercrest Theatre)**

On-call observed the Stagelight seat-map renderer returning blank balcony sections for roughly 30% of requests. Root cause traced to a stale layout cache entry produced after the venue reconfiguration import at 13:57; the renderer silently fell back to an empty polygon set instead of erroring. Mitigation: cache flush at 14:31 restored full rendering; a guard rejecting zero-polygon layouts shipped in the hotfix. The hotfix was validated against the build recorded below.

session token of fahap-hawip = htk31_7852f2b3276dba2738f98fa97f92237